  • The Learning Organization

  • Organizational learning is the process through which managers instill in all members of an organization a desire to find new ways to improve organizational effectiveness.

  • Five activities are central to a learning organization:

Encouragement of personal mastery or high self-efficacy.

Development of complex schemas to understand work activities.

Encouragement of learning in groups and teams.

Communicating a shared vision for the organization as a whole.

Encouraging systematic thinking.


  • Knowledge management is the ability to capitalize on the knowledge possessed by organizational members which is not necessarily written down anywhere or codified in formal documents.
